Real Estate Repairs

In most real estate transactions there are a few responsibilities that the sellers need to handle before the closing, such as repairs and termite extermination. The deadline for completing these obligations usually coincides with the actual closing. Many sellers procrastinate and have to rush to get the required items repaired.  Don't wait!  Those who wait until the last minute to handle these matters may miss the deadline altogether or pay high rates in order to get a plumber, roofer or electrician on an emergency basis.

Your buyers will most likely get a home inspection done after the contract is ratified. Within 30 days of the contract's closing date,  the termite moisture inspection will be scheduled. Even though sellers usually know well in advance what is needed, they sometimes put things off until the buyers have finalized the loan approval process. Since these repairs will have to be made anyway, it is a good idea to get them done promptly so as not to hold up the closing.  As soon as the repairs are agreed upon, go ahead and make your repairs..You'll be glad you did!
